When my dealer tried to activate my Sirius account (2014 RT) he was also told that it was only 2 months. He said he would check into it and see if he could fix it - which he later did. I now have a year subscription (Sirius Full Access). He told me he had to use the dealer code for activation instead of my ESN which he has never had to do before that. My RT was the first 2014 he had tried to activate. Not sure of the exact procedure but it is fixed. Hope this helps.

Sirius, What a pain to deal with. I had my 600 mile service yesterday and while there I talked with them about my propblem with Sirius. I called them with my dealer by my side, it all went fine just a hell of a lot of BS but they gave me the 12 months. At home I open the comfirming email, yep it showed 2 months! Called again today they told me there are problem in the system and it will be worked out. They got to it quickly because the accout is now at 12 months. I’m able to see this online with my other Sirius XM accounts. If you have it in you, keep on them…
